Items We Cannot Move
For safety, legal and insurance reasons, there are some items we normally cannot carry:
- Flammable or hazardous materials (e.g. petrol, gas cylinders, paints, chemicals)
- Illegal substances or items
- Unboxed loose liquids (e.g. opened cleaning products)
- Live animals or pets
- High-value cash, jewellery or irreplaceable documents – we recommend you carry these personally
If you’re unsure about a particular item, we will advise you clearly during the survey.

Frequently Asked Questions
How much does a removals service in Docklands cost?
The cost of a removals service in Docklands depends mainly on the volume of items, access at each property, the distance between addresses and whether you require packing. Smaller flat moves may be priced on an hourly basis, while larger house or office relocations are usually quoted at a fixed price following a survey. All quotes from Removals Docklands are itemised, so you can see exactly what is included. There are no hidden charges, and we explain any potential additional costs, such as parking fees, in advance.
Can you handle same-day or urgent removals?
We can often accommodate same-day or short-notice moves within Docklands, depending on vehicle and crew availability. Urgent removals are usually more straightforward if you are flexible on start time and service level, for example using your own packing where possible. The more detail you provide when you contact us, the more accurately we can confirm what is achievable on the day. While we can’t guarantee availability for every request, we will always be honest about what we can do and suggest practical alternatives if needed.

How is a professional removals company different from a man-and-van?
A casual man-and-van service typically offers simple transport with basic labour, whereas a professional removals company provides a planned, fully managed move. With Removals Docklands you get trained staff, fully insured vehicles, proper packing materials and equipment, and a clear contract outlining responsibilities. We carry out surveys, liaise over parking and access, and can handle complex requirements such as office relocations and multi-drop moves. This reduces the risk of damage, delays or misunderstandings, and is particularly important for larger properties, valuable items or time-sensitive moves.
How far in advance should I book my removal?
We recommend booking your removal as soon as you have a confirmed moving date, especially for Fridays, month-ends and peak summer periods which fill up quickly. For most home moves, two to four weeks’ notice provides a good balance between certainty and flexibility. That said, we regularly accommodate shorter-notice bookings in Docklands when our schedule allows. Even if your date is not fixed, it is worth contacting us early so we can provisionally hold a slot and advise you on packing, access and any preparations that will make moving day smoother.
